This Technology Is No Longer Available

Adobe Flash was discontinued in December 2020. All major browsers have removed Flash support entirely. Flash Chat and all other Flash-based applications can no longer run on the web.

If you are looking for live chat on your website, modern alternatives include Tawk.to (free), LiveChat, and Zendesk Chat, all of which run on standard HTML and JavaScript with no plugins required.
